جاوا اسکریپت(Java Script):
-نرم افزار نویسی گوشی
جاوا اسکریپت یک گویش اپ نویسی سطح بالا است که طراحی اپلیکیشن دارنده قابلیت و امکان چندالگویی بودن میباشد. این لهجه هم شیء گرا بوده و هم قابلیت اپلیکیشن نویسی فانکشنال را برای یوزرها مهیا می کند.
اپلیکیشن نویسی فانکشنال:
درواقع یک نرمافزارنویسی تابعگرا میباشد. این اپلیکیشن نویسی در دسته اپلیکیشننویسی اعلانی قرار می گیرد. در این راه از اپنویسی ما به سیستم میگوییم می خواهیم که چه چیزی واقعه بیفتد جای اینکه به سیستم بگوییم به چه شکل فعالیت را انجام دهد.
اپ نویسی جاوا اسکریپت به طور همگانی برای پباده سازی اپ ها ساخت نشده میباشد:
بلکه عمل آن پباده سازی و در دست گرفتن صفحه های اینترنت میباشد. البته برای ساختوساز نرمافزار های تلفن همراه با به کار گیری از جاوا اسکریپت بایستی از CSS، HTML و AJAX استعمال فرمائید. پلتفرم های مختلفی وجود داراست که در آنها می اقتدار با به کارگیری از لهجه نرمافزار نویسی جاوا اسکریپت یک نرم افزار تلفن همراه ساخت نمود که به عنوان مثال آنان می قدرت PhoneGap، jQuery Mobile و Lonic را اسم پیروزی.
پباده سازی نرمافزار به گویش جاوا اسکریپت چه مزیتی داراست؟
یک مزیت عمده دارااست و آن هم این میباشد، هنگامی که شما یک نرم افزار را با به کارگیری از جاوا اسکریپت ساخت و ساز مینمایید نیاز به کد نویسی منقطع برای ساخت و ساز آن نرمافزار در اندروید، ویندوز و iOS ندارید و صرفا کافیست یک توشه کد آن را بنویسید تا بتوانید آن را در همگی پلتفرم ها اجرا کنید.
وبسایت درسمن برای اشخاصی که قصد فراگیری جاوا اسکریپت را دارا هستند، عصر های آموزشی را به طور معمولی و تماما کاربردی در چنگ شما قرار داده میباشد، کافی میباشد بر روی یادگرفتن جاوا اسکریپت کلیک نمایید.
Html5:
html-اپلیکیشن نویسی تلفن همراه
همانطور که از اسم گویش نرم افزار نویسی HTML5 معین میباشد این لهجه پنجمین ورژن از گویش نرمافزار نویسی HTML میباشد. شما میتوانید یک نرمافزار تلفن همراه را در HTML5 با یاری جاوا اسکریپت و CSS ساخت فرمائید. همینطور این گویش را به طور ترکیبی با API ها می قدرت بهره مند شد. در هر شکل اپ های ساخت گردیده با به کار گیری از HTML5 ریسپانسیو میباشند و بر روی همه دستگاه ها قابل انجام میباشند. شما میتوانید با به کارگیری از HTML5 نرمافزار هایی برای اندروید، ویندوز و iOS تولید فرمائید. صرفا چیزی که برای انجام این فعالیت به آن نیاز خواهید داشت به کار گیری از یک کادر ورک توانمند مانند PhoneGap است.
این بدان مفهوم میباشد که شما تنها یک توشه کد می نویسید و بعد میتوانید کد درج شده را بر روی همگی دستگاه ها اجرا کنید.
شاید بتوان اعلام کرد صدها نرم افزار اینترنت وجود داراهستند که شما روزمره از آن ها به کارگیری مینمایید و آن ها با به کارگیری از HTML5 ساختوساز گردیده اند. شاید برای شما دیدنی باشد که بدانید Google Docs و Google Drive با به کارگیری از HTML5 پباده سازی گردیده اند.
شاید بپرسید هنگامی که گویش های اپلیکیشن نویسی بی نیاز بسیار متعددی وجود داراست که می قدرت برای پباده سازی یک نرمافزار گوشی از آنان بهره برد چرا بایستی از HTML5 برای پباده سازی نرمافزار ها به کارگیری کنم؟
در پایین عارضه ها این مساله نقل شده میباشد:
HTML5 از جانب مرورگر های گوشی و مرورگر های دسکتاپ به طور بدون نقص پذیرفته گردیده است.
این گویش دارنده قابلیت و امکان پشتیبانی متقابل مرورگرها میباشد.
قابلیت و امکان کدنویسی معمولی و پاک در آن.
دارنده قابلیت پشتیبانی بی نقص از ویدیوها و پوشه های صوتی
به جهت داشتن قابلیت پشتیبانی متقابل مرورگرها و ریسپانسیو بودن آن، کدهای درج شده در آن بر روی کلیه دستگاه ها قابل انجام است.
خب پس با دیدن این امکان های گویش نرمافزار نویسی HTML5 شاید مدت آن رسیده باشد که به طور دور از شوخی خیس به یادگیری HTML5 تصور کنید.
معرفی 2 لهجه دیگر نرمافزار نویسی گوشی:
Buildfire.js:
buildfire-اپلیکیشن نویسی گوشی
این گویش اپلیکیشن نویسی از یک SDK با اسم SDK BuildFire و همینطور از جاوا اسکریپت به کار گیری می نماید تا برای یوزرها این قابلیت و امکان را آماده نماید که با سود گیری از تجهیزات و قابلیت و امکان های بک اند آن با سرعت و کیفیت بالایی اپ های تلفن همراه متبوع خویش را ساخت کنند.
با استعمال از BuildFire.js شما میتوانید 70% از کارهایی که در پباده سازی به طور معمول برای پباده سازی نرمافزار ها ما یحتاج میباشد را صرفا با نصب چندین افزونه به طور معمولی انجام دهید. می قدرت اعلام کرد که 70% از عمل به طور خودکار انجام میگردد و شما صرفا می بایست بدانید که تلاش های مشخصی که هریک از مشتری ها از برنامه خویش انتظار داراهستند چه است و آنانرا در یک طبقه بندی معلوم برای خویش انتخاب فرمایید.
بعد از آنکه تلاش های آیتم انتظار مشتری از نرم افزار گزینش شوید دیگر نیازی به انجام پباده سازی ها از نخست نمیباشد و شما فقط با استعمال از افزونه ها میتوانید قسمت عمده ای از شغل های اساسی را به انجام برسانید. این بدان معنا میباشد که عمل شما بسیار بی آلایش خیس، سریع خیس و بی دردسر خیس خواهد بود و شما میتوانید در حین کوتاه تری برنامه های بیشتری را ساخت کنید.
علاوه بر مجموع آنچه که گفته شد BuildFire.js دارنده معماری بسیار انعطاف پذیری است که به شما این قابلیت و امکان را میدهد که از هر کادر ورک جاوا اسکریپت که موردنیاز باشد به کارگیری فرمائید.
SQL:
sql-اپلیکیشن نویسی تلفن همراه
اس کیو ال یا این که SQL مخفف عبارت Structured Query Language هست. این گویش در مدیر سیستم مقر داده ارتباط ای، پردازش داده و چک مقر های داده کاربرد دارااست. از SQL برای بسط نرم افزار های تلفن همراه به کارگیری نمیشود بلکه این گویش برای پشتیبانی نرمافزار ها کاربرد دارااست. هنگامی که در پباده سازی و اجرای یک نرمافزار تلفن همراه نیاز به دسترسی به داده های جان دار در سرور داشته باشید،SQL به امداد شما خواهد آمد.
ضرورتا SQL صرفا زبانی میباشد که با پباده سازی کلیه نرمافزار های گوشی آمیخته شدهاست. یعنی شما برای پباده سازی اکثر برنامه ها نیاز به SQL خواهید داشت و لذا می قدرت بیان کرد که یادگیری آن یک آپشن وجود ندارد بلکه یک ضرورت میباشد.
جاوا اسکریپت(Java Script):
-نرم افزار نویسی گوشی
جاوا اسکریپت یک گویش اپ نویسی سطح بالا است که طراحی اپلیکیشن دارنده قابلیت و امکان چندالگویی بودن میباشد. این لهجه هم شیء گرا بوده و هم قابلیت اپلیکیشن نویسی فانکشنال را برای یوزرها مهیا می کند.
اپلیکیشن نویسی فانکشنال:
درواقع یک نرمافزارنویسی تابعگرا میباشد. این اپلیکیشن نویسی در دسته اپلیکیشننویسی اعلانی قرار می گیرد. در این راه از اپنویسی ما به سیستم میگوییم می خواهیم که چه چیزی واقعه بیفتد جای اینکه به سیستم بگوییم به چه شکل فعالیت را انجام دهد.
اپ نویسی جاوا اسکریپت به طور همگانی برای پباده سازی اپ ها ساخت نشده میباشد:
بلکه عمل آن پباده سازی و در دست گرفتن صفحه های اینترنت میباشد. البته برای ساختوساز نرمافزار های تلفن همراه با به کار گیری از جاوا اسکریپت بایستی از CSS، HTML و AJAX استعمال فرمائید. پلتفرم های مختلفی وجود داراست که در آنها می اقتدار با به کارگیری از لهجه نرمافزار نویسی جاوا اسکریپت یک نرم افزار تلفن همراه ساخت نمود که به عنوان مثال آنان می قدرت PhoneGap، jQuery Mobile و Lonic را اسم پیروزی.
پباده سازی نرمافزار به گویش جاوا اسکریپت چه مزیتی داراست؟
یک مزیت عمده دارااست و آن هم این میباشد، هنگامی که شما یک نرم افزار را با به کارگیری از جاوا اسکریپت ساخت و ساز مینمایید نیاز به کد نویسی منقطع برای ساخت و ساز آن نرمافزار در اندروید، ویندوز و iOS ندارید و صرفا کافیست یک توشه کد آن را بنویسید تا بتوانید آن را در همگی پلتفرم ها اجرا کنید.
وبسایت درسمن برای اشخاصی که قصد فراگیری جاوا اسکریپت را دارا هستند، عصر های آموزشی را به طور معمولی و تماما کاربردی در چنگ شما قرار داده میباشد، کافی میباشد بر روی یادگرفتن جاوا اسکریپت کلیک نمایید.
Html5:
html-اپلیکیشن نویسی تلفن همراه
همانطور که از اسم گویش نرم افزار نویسی HTML5 معین میباشد این لهجه پنجمین ورژن از گویش نرمافزار نویسی HTML میباشد. شما میتوانید یک نرمافزار تلفن همراه را در HTML5 با یاری جاوا اسکریپت و CSS ساخت فرمائید. همینطور این گویش را به طور ترکیبی با API ها می قدرت بهره مند شد. در هر شکل اپ های ساخت گردیده با به کار گیری از HTML5 ریسپانسیو میباشند و بر روی همه دستگاه ها قابل انجام میباشند. شما میتوانید با به کارگیری از HTML5 نرمافزار هایی برای اندروید، ویندوز و iOS تولید فرمائید. صرفا چیزی که برای انجام این فعالیت به آن نیاز خواهید داشت به کار گیری از یک کادر ورک توانمند مانند PhoneGap است.
این بدان مفهوم میباشد که شما تنها یک توشه کد می نویسید و بعد میتوانید کد درج شده را بر روی همگی دستگاه ها اجرا کنید.
شاید بتوان اعلام کرد صدها نرم افزار اینترنت وجود داراهستند که شما روزمره از آن ها به کارگیری مینمایید و آن ها با به کارگیری از HTML5 ساختوساز گردیده اند. شاید برای شما دیدنی باشد که بدانید Google Docs و Google Drive با به کارگیری از HTML5 پباده سازی گردیده اند.
شاید بپرسید هنگامی که گویش های اپلیکیشن نویسی بی نیاز بسیار متعددی وجود داراست که می قدرت برای پباده سازی یک نرمافزار گوشی از آنان بهره برد چرا بایستی از HTML5 برای پباده سازی نرمافزار ها به کارگیری کنم؟
در پایین عارضه ها این مساله نقل شده میباشد:
HTML5 از جانب مرورگر های گوشی و مرورگر های دسکتاپ به طور بدون نقص پذیرفته گردیده است.
این گویش دارنده قابلیت و امکان پشتیبانی متقابل مرورگرها میباشد.
قابلیت و امکان کدنویسی معمولی و پاک در آن.
دارنده قابلیت پشتیبانی بی نقص از ویدیوها و پوشه های صوتی
به جهت داشتن قابلیت پشتیبانی متقابل مرورگرها و ریسپانسیو بودن آن، کدهای درج شده در آن بر روی کلیه دستگاه ها قابل انجام است.
خب پس با دیدن این امکان های گویش نرمافزار نویسی HTML5 شاید مدت آن رسیده باشد که به طور دور از شوخی خیس به یادگیری HTML5 تصور کنید.
معرفی 2 لهجه دیگر نرمافزار نویسی گوشی:
Buildfire.js:
buildfire-اپلیکیشن نویسی گوشی
این گویش اپلیکیشن نویسی از یک SDK با اسم SDK BuildFire و همینطور از جاوا اسکریپت به کار گیری می نماید تا برای یوزرها این قابلیت و امکان را آماده نماید که با سود گیری از تجهیزات و قابلیت و امکان های بک اند آن با سرعت و کیفیت بالایی اپ های تلفن همراه متبوع خویش را ساخت کنند.
با استعمال از BuildFire.js شما میتوانید 70% از کارهایی که در پباده سازی به طور معمول برای پباده سازی نرمافزار ها ما یحتاج میباشد را صرفا با نصب چندین افزونه به طور معمولی انجام دهید. می قدرت اعلام کرد که 70% از عمل به طور خودکار انجام میگردد و شما صرفا می بایست بدانید که تلاش های مشخصی که هریک از مشتری ها از برنامه خویش انتظار داراهستند چه است و آنانرا در یک طبقه بندی معلوم برای خویش انتخاب فرمایید.
بعد از آنکه تلاش های آیتم انتظار مشتری از نرم افزار گزینش شوید دیگر نیازی به انجام پباده سازی ها از نخست نمیباشد و شما فقط با استعمال از افزونه ها میتوانید قسمت عمده ای از شغل های اساسی را به انجام برسانید. این بدان معنا میباشد که عمل شما بسیار بی آلایش خیس، سریع خیس و بی دردسر خیس خواهد بود و شما میتوانید در حین کوتاه تری برنامه های بیشتری را ساخت کنید.
علاوه بر مجموع آنچه که گفته شد BuildFire.js دارنده معماری بسیار انعطاف پذیری است که به شما این قابلیت و امکان را میدهد که از هر کادر ورک جاوا اسکریپت که موردنیاز باشد به کارگیری فرمائید.
SQL:
sql-اپلیکیشن نویسی تلفن همراه
اس کیو ال یا این که SQL مخفف عبارت Structured Query Language هست. این گویش در مدیر سیستم مقر داده ارتباط ای، پردازش داده و چک مقر های داده کاربرد دارااست. از SQL برای بسط نرم افزار های تلفن همراه به کارگیری نمیشود بلکه این گویش برای پشتیبانی نرمافزار ها کاربرد دارااست. هنگامی که در پباده سازی و اجرای یک نرمافزار تلفن همراه نیاز به دسترسی به داده های جان دار در سرور داشته باشید،SQL به امداد شما خواهد آمد.
ضرورتا SQL صرفا زبانی میباشد که با پباده سازی کلیه نرمافزار های گوشی آمیخته شدهاست. یعنی شما برای پباده سازی اکثر برنامه ها نیاز به SQL خواهید داشت و لذا می قدرت بیان کرد که یادگیری آن یک آپشن وجود ندارد بلکه یک ضرورت میباشد.